This Saturday, September 28, the island of Ibiza will be the venue for the fifth stage of the t100 Triathlon World Tour. This is the new name of the PTO Tour and it is a world circuit of seven T100 races that are being contested throughout the 2024 season and consist of 100 km (2 km swim, 80 km bike and 18 km run). The world’s best triathletes have already faced each other in Miami, Singapore, San Francisco and London and after Ibiza, the battle will continue in Las Vegas (October 19-20) and in the final of the T100 Championship in Dubai (November 16-17). All the races can be followed live all over the world (more than 195 territories) being Eurosport and TV3 the ones that will offer for Spain the Ibiza show.
There are seven T100 events throughout the season, with the Ibiza T100 being the fifth leg of the circuit. (A total of $250,000 in prize money is awarded in each series.) Triathletes score differently depending on their results and the top three scores, plus the Dubai T100 Final, are the ones that ultimately count towards the final women’s and men’s T100 World Championship standings.
The champions will pocket $210,000. Thus, between the triathletes’ contracts, the prize purse for each T100 race and the T100 Triathlon World Tour pool, the T100 Triathlon World Tour provides more than $7 million in prize money.
Sara Pérez Sala, Susana Rodríguez’s guide at the JJPP (winning the gold medal), Javi Gómez Noya, who will relive his historic duel with Alistair Bronwlee and Antonio Benito (World Long Distance champion), will be the Spanish representatives of a dream Starlist with names Sam Laidlow, India Lee Lucy Charles-Barclay. The women’s race will start at 10:30 a.m. on Saturday, September 28, while the men’s race will start earlier, at 08:00 a.m., both from Playa Ses Figueretes.
